Louisville City FC will continue a well-traveled month at 4 p.m. Saturday when kicking off for the first time against USL Championship expansion club Rhode Island FC.

LouCity already visited the Pacific Time Zone twice in May, making the roughly 4,600-mile round trip to Seattle for U.S. Open Cup play before last weekend’s 3,800-mile jaunt to and from Las Vegas for a league game.


It will be another 1,900 or so miles there and back, this time to the East Coast. Rhode Island hosts its home games at Beirne Stadium, originally built as the home of Bryant University’s football team.

To complicate matters for coach Danny Cruz, there’s a quick turnaround to consider. Following Saturday’s game, LouCity hosts Detroit City FC on Wednesday night at Lynn Family Stadium. Then it’s back on the road for a weekend trip to play Miami FC.

City (7-1-1, 22 points) holds second on the Eastern Conference table, five points back of the Charleston Battery. However, Charleston has played two more games than the boys in purple.

Rhode Island (1-3-6, 9 points) is getting results early in its first season, including a scoreless tie with the Battery. But a high number of draws has the club 11th of 12 in the East.

Rhode Island’s lone win came back on April 20 at, coincidentally, Las Vegas Lights FC, which LouCity played to a 2-2 draw last out. RIFC is still in search of its first home victory.

Potent offense: With another pair of goals at Las Vegas, LouCity pushed its season total to a USL Championship-leading 28. City is also one of three clubs around the league to have hit the back of the net in each of its games this year along with the Indy Eleven and Sacramento Republic FC.
